Flye 'n' Frie in... Ultra Scaled Skies 64 (or simply Ultra Scaled Skies 64) is an upcoming platform video game, developed by Studio RGB-Newt and published by The Fishal Project, for the Nintendo 64.

The game is the second out of 6 titles in the "Historic N Series" of Flye 'n' Frie homebrew games for Nintendo home consoles, all six of which will be bundled together in the Flye 'n' Frie: Classic Collection for PC, and are otherwise released as separate N64 ROM files that are playable in emulators or on real Nintendo 64 (or N64-compatible) hardware through physical cartridges.
